#dc033e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#dc033e is composed of 86.3% red, 1.2%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.6% magenta, 71.8%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 343.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 43.7%. #dc033e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ff067c with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

● #dc033e color description : Vivid pink.
The hexadecimal color #dc033e has RGB values of R:220, G:3,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.72,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14418750.
